A Legacy Forged in Advertising: From Humble Beginnings to Global Icon

Rolex's success wasn't solely built on exceptional watchmaking; it's inextricably linked to its shrewd and consistently elegant advertising strategies. Early Rolex advertisements, often found in vintage magazines and newspapers, focused on highlighting the watch's durability and precision. These ads, while simpler in design compared to modern campaigns, effectively communicated the brand's core values: reliability, accuracy, and a commitment to pushing the boundaries of horological engineering. They often featured close-up shots of the watches, emphasizing the intricate details and showcasing the craftsmanship involved in their creation. The emphasis was on functionality and performance, appealing to a discerning clientele who valued quality above all else.

As the brand grew, so did the sophistication of its advertising. Rolex moved beyond simple product shots, incorporating aspirational imagery and storytelling. This shift reflected a broader understanding of luxury marketing, moving beyond mere functionality to encompass a lifestyle and an ethos. The advertisements began to feature individuals who embodied the Rolex values – adventurers, explorers, athletes, and pioneers. This strategic shift positioned Rolex not just as a timepiece but as a symbol of achievement, ambition, and a life lived to the fullest.

The Power of the Moving Image: Rolex Commercials Through the Decades

Rolex commercials have played a crucial role in shaping the brand's public image. From early black-and-white films showcasing the watch's robustness to today's meticulously crafted cinematic productions, Rolex commercials consistently maintain a high level of production quality and artistic vision. These commercials often tell compelling stories, weaving narratives of exploration, perseverance, and the pursuit of excellence.

Examining Rolex commercials from the past offers a fascinating glimpse into the evolution of both the brand and advertising techniques. Earlier commercials frequently focused on demonstrating the watch's resilience in extreme conditions, using scenarios like deep-sea diving or mountain climbing to highlight its durability and reliability. These commercials played a significant role in establishing the Rolex Oyster's reputation for unparalleled water resistance and shock resistance.

More recent Rolex commercials have become increasingly sophisticated, using evocative imagery and subtle storytelling to connect with viewers on an emotional level. They often feature renowned figures from various fields, further reinforcing the brand's association with achievement and success. These commercials are less about explicitly showcasing the watch's features and more about evoking a feeling, an aspiration, a sense of belonging to a world of excellence and prestige.
